Find the volume and solve the application.

A mason's assistant's rate of pay is $0.95 per cubic foot of earth moved. He digs a trench 2.5 ft. wide by 2 ft. deep by 150 ft. in length. What is his pay for this job?

The trench has the shape of a rectangular prism.
The volume of a rectangular prism is

V = length * width * height, or simply

V = LWH

We now use the given dimensions in the formula to find the volume,

V = 150 ft * 2.5 ft * 2 ft = 750 ft^3

The volume of the tranch is 750 ft^3.

The assistant is paid $0.95 per cubic foot, so we now multiply this unit rate by the total number of cubic feet in the trench.

pay = unit rate * volume

pay = $0.95/(ft^3) * 750 ft^3 = $712.50

Answer: The assistant is paid $712.50.
